Back Bay Rugby Football Club (Back Bay RFC) competes in the Southern California Rugby Football Union 3rd Division.[1] The club was founded in 1985 with the consolidation of two first division clubs, Irvine Coast and Newport Beach. Consolidated with Huntington Beach Unicorns as the Beach City Narwahls.
Pitch[edit]
The Back Bay RFC practice pitch is located at St. John the Baptist School in Costa Mesa. Home league matches are played at Peninsula Park, located on A Street in Newport Beach.
Club Honors[edit]
- 2015 Southern California Rugby Football Union (SCRFU) Division 2 Champions
- 2009 Southern California Rugby Football Union (SCRFU) Division 2 Champions
Capped players[edit]
The following former Back Bay players have been capped by the USA Rugby Union National Team, known as the "Eagles."
- Ed Burlingham
- Brian Surgener[2]
- David Fee
